Establishing premise
Fino Payments Bank, founded in 2017, is a digital-first bank with a vast merchant network across India. Initially, it focused on assisted banking through outlets and merchants for savings accounts, payments, and utility services. By 2022, the bank aimed to scale faster, enhance customer convenience, and tap into the post-COVID shift towards digital adoption. With this vision, they partnered with the design studio to reimagine an end-to-end banking solution tailored for millennials.
Key functionalities they envisioned
1. Seamless digital onboarding journey– instant account opening with Aadhaar/PAN/Video KYC.
2. Goal based savings vault – sub-accounts for personal savings goals with flexible deposits/withdrawals.
3. Rewards & loyalty system – cashback, offers, and gamified engagement through Fino Fortune & Fino Fun.
4. Easy payments & financial dashboard – quick UPI/QR/Bill Pay with a smart dashboard to track spends.
What I worked on
Within the brief period of 2 months of internship, I got an opportunity to work on designing a seamless self onboarding experience for Fino’s mobile application. As per the POC from Fino Payments Bank:
Wanted to create a Self-Service Experience
1. To cut the cost of acquisition by reducing dependency on middlemen.
2. To extend the bank’s reach beyond physical touchpoints.
3. To allow customers to onboard themselves anytime and anywhere without friction.
Wanted to cater to Millennials
1. They wanted to expand into Tier-1 cities where millennials are most tech-savvy with financial power.
2. Millennials are more likely to adopt and engage with a digital bank experience.
3. They value speed and simplicity, which matched the banking experience Fino wanted to create.
Intended Outcome
Accelerate Digital Onboarding
Expanding customer acquisition by enabling more users to seamlessly open savings accounts through a digital-first experience.
Improve Conversion Rates
Minimizing drop-offs in the onboarding journey by introducing smoother flows, contextual nudges, and engaging user touchpoints.
Faster Account Opening
Reducing the overall time taken to open an account, ensuring a quick, hassle-free, and convenient banking process.
